Server-Side Tracking Uitgelegd: Waarom Je Tot 30% Data Mist
Ad blockers, ITP en privacy-regelgeving zorgen ervoor dat je tot 30% van je websitedata mist. Server-side tracking is de oplossing. We leggen uit hoe het werkt en waarom het essentieel is.

Stel je voor: je investeert maandelijks honderden of zelfs duizenden euro's in Google Ads, maar je analytics-data vertelt je maar 70% van het verhaal. Klinkt frustrerend? Dat is de realiteit voor de meeste bedrijven die nog volledig op traditionele client-side tracking vertrouwen.
In dit artikel leggen we uit wat server-side tracking is, waarom je waarschijnlijk data mist, en hoe je dit kunt oplossen.
Het Probleem: Waarom Mis Je Data?
Voordat we de oplossing bespreken, is het goed om te begrijpen waar het probleem vandaan komt. Er zijn vier grote oorzaken waardoor je tracking-data onvolledig is.
1. Ad Blockers
Naar schatting 25-40% van de internetgebruikers heeft een ad blocker geïnstalleerd. De meeste ad blockers blokkeren behalve advertenties ook tracking scripts zoals Google Analytics en de Facebook Pixel.
Dat betekent dat een aanzienlijk deel van je bezoekers compleet onzichtbaar is in je analytics. Je ziet ze niet binnenkomen, je ziet hun gedrag niet, en je ziet hun conversies niet.
2. Intelligent Tracking Prevention (ITP)
Apple's Safari-browser (gebruikt door ongeveer 20-25% van de Belgische internetgebruikers) heeft Intelligent Tracking Prevention ingebouwd. ITP beperkt de levensduur van cookies:
- First-party cookies via JavaScript hebben een maximum van 7 dagen
- Third-party cookies worden volledig geblokkeerd
- Query parameters uit link decoration worden na 24 uur verwijderd
Dit betekent dat als een bezoeker via Safari je website bezoekt, wegaat, en na 8 dagen terugkomt en een aankoop doet, je die conversie niet meer kunt koppelen aan de oorspronkelijke bron.
3. Firefox Enhanced Tracking Protection
Firefox blokkeert standaard third-party tracking cookies en heeft steeds strengere privacy-maatregelen. Met een marktaandeel van ongeveer 5-8% in België draagt dit bij aan het dataverlies.
4. Cookie Consent en GDPR
In België en de rest van Europa ben je verplicht om toestemming te vragen voordat je tracking cookies plaatst. Gemiddeld geeft slechts 50-70% van de bezoekers toestemming. De rest wordt niet getrackt.
Het Totale Verlies
Als je al deze factoren combineert, is het realistisch dat je 20-30% van je websitedata mist. Voor een bedrijf dat maandelijks €5.000 aan Google Ads uitgeeft, betekent dit dat je potentieel honderden conversies niet ziet en dus niet kunt optimaliseren.

Wat is Client-Side Tracking?
Om server-side tracking te begrijpen, moeten we eerst kijken naar hoe traditionele tracking werkt.
Bij client-side tracking draait alles in de browser van de bezoeker:
- Een bezoeker opent je website
- De browser laadt je tracking scripts (Google Analytics, Facebook Pixel, etc.)
- Deze scripts verzamelen data over het gedrag van de bezoeker
- De data wordt vanuit de browser rechtstreeks naar Google/Facebook/etc. gestuurd
Het probleem: alles gebeurt in de browser. En de browser is precies de plek waar ad blockers, ITP, en cookie consent ingrijpen.
Visueel voorgesteld
Bezoeker → Browser → [Ad Blocker / ITP / Consent] → Google Analytics
↑
Hier gaat data verloren
Wat is Server-Side Tracking?
Bij server-side tracking verloopt de data niet rechtstreeks vanuit de browser naar Google of Facebook. In plaats daarvan stuurt de browser de data naar jouw eigen server, die het vervolgens doorstuurt naar de analytics-platforms.
Hoe werkt het in de praktijk?
- Een bezoeker opent je website
- De browser stuurt data naar jouw eigen (first-party) server endpoint
- Jouw server verwerkt de data
- De server stuurt de data door naar Google Analytics, Google Ads, Facebook, etc.
Visueel voorgesteld
Bezoeker → Browser → Jouw Server → Google Analytics
→ Google Ads
→ Facebook
Waarom lost dit het probleem op?
- De meeste ad blockers herkennen calls naar third-party domeinen (google-analytics.com). Maar als de data naar jouw eigen domein gaat (bijvoorbeeld tracking.jouwbedrijf.be), wordt dit niet geblokkeerd.
- Cookies die door een server worden gezet (HTTP cookies) hebben een langere levensduur dan JavaScript cookies. Server-set first-party cookies worden door ITP niet beperkt tot 7 dagen.
- Je bepaalt zelf welke data je doorstuurt en kunt gevoelige informatie filteren voordat het naar derde partijen gaat.
Server-Side Google Tag Manager
De meest gebruikte implementatie van server-side tracking is via Server-Side Google Tag Manager (sGTM).
Hoe werkt sGTM?
Google Tag Manager heeft naast de traditionele web container ook een server container. Deze draait op een cloud server (meestal Google Cloud Platform) en fungeert als tussenpersoon tussen de browser en de analytics-platforms.
De architectuur
De setup bestaat uit drie lagen. De web container (client-side) stuurt data naar je server container via een first-party endpoint. De server container ontvangt de data, verwerkt deze, en stuurt door naar de juiste bestemmingen. Daar draaien tags voor GA4, Google Ads conversions, Facebook CAPI, en meer.
Voordelen van sGTM
Alle data loopt via jouw domein, waardoor je een first-party context behoudt. Server-set cookies omzeilen ITP-beperkingen, wat zorgt voor langere cookie-levensduur. Doordat er minder JavaScript in de browser draait, wordt je website sneller. Bovendien kun je server-side data toevoegen (CRM-data, klantwaarde) en PII filteren voordat het naar derde partijen gaat.
Enhanced Conversions: De Perfecte Aanvulling
Enhanced Conversions is een Google-functie die perfect samenwerkt met server-side tracking. Het stelt je in staat om gehashte klantgegevens (email, telefoon, naam, adres) mee te sturen met je conversies.
Waarom is dit belangrijk?
Google gebruikt deze gehashte data om conversies te matchen met gebruikers, zelfs als cookies niet beschikbaar zijn. Dit verhoogt je conversie-attributie met 10-15%.
Hoe werkt het?
- Een klant vult een formulier in of doet een aankoop
- De klantgegevens worden gehasht (versleuteld) met SHA-256
- De gehashte data wordt meegestuurd met de conversie-tag
- Google matcht de gehashte data met ingelogde Google-gebruikers
- De conversie wordt correct geattribueerd, zelfs zonder cookies
Enhanced Conversions via sGTM
De ideale setup combineert enhanced conversions met server-side tracking. Server-side tags kunnen data verrijken met backend-informatie, wat hogere match rates oplevert door meer datapunten. Tegelijkertijd wordt de data gehasht voordat het je server verlaat, zodat alles privacy-compliant blijft.
Wat Zijn de Kosten en Overwegingen?
Server-side tracking is geen gratis lunch. Er zijn een paar zaken om rekening mee te houden.
Hosting Kosten
Je server container draait op een cloud platform, meestal Google Cloud Platform (GCP). De kosten hangen af van je traffic:
- Bij klein verkeer (tot ~100.000 hits/maand) betaal je vanaf een paar euro per maand
- Bij gemiddeld verkeer (100.000 - 1.000.000 hits/maand) gaat het om tientallen euro's per maand
- Bij hoog verkeer (1.000.000+ hits/maand) schalen de kosten mee, maar ze blijven relatief laag vergeleken met je advertentiebudget
Technische Complexiteit
De setup is complexer dan standaard client-side tracking:
- Je hebt kennis nodig van cloud platforms
- DNS-configuratie voor je custom domein
- Configuratie van de server container
- Testing en validatie van de data flow
Onderhoud
Net als je web container moet je server container worden onderhouden:
- Tags updaten
- Nieuwe integraties toevoegen
- Monitoring van de server health
- Kosten in de gaten houden
Is Server-Side Tracking de Moeite Waard?
Het korte antwoord: ja, voor de meeste bedrijven die serieus adverteren.
Server-side tracking is essentieel als:
- Je maandelijks meer dan €1.000 aan online advertenties uitgeeft
- Je merkt dat je conversie-aantallen in Google Ads niet kloppen met je werkelijke verkopen
- Je een groot aandeel Safari-gebruikers hebt
- Je wilt voldoen aan GDPR zonder al je data te verliezen
- Je je ROAS wilt verbeteren door betere data
Server-side tracking is minder urgent als:
- Je een heel kleine website hebt met weinig traffic
- Je niet adverteert en analytics puur informatief gebruikt
- Je budget voor setup en onderhoud zeer beperkt is
De Impact op je Google Ads Prestaties
Betere data leidt direct tot betere campagneresultaten. Smart Bidding werkt beter omdat Google's algoritmes meer conversie-data hebben om mee te optimaliseren. Je remarketing-lijsten zijn vollediger, je weet welke campagnes en keywords écht converteren, en door betere optimalisatie krijg je meer resultaat uit hetzelfde budget.
Bedrijven die overstappen op server-side tracking zien gemiddeld een 15-25% verhoging in gerapporteerde conversies en een merkbare verbetering in hun campagneprestaties.
Aan de Slag
Server-side tracking implementeren is een technisch project, maar het rendement is het meer dan waard. De stappen in het kort:
- Audit je huidige tracking: hoeveel data mis je nu?
- Plan je architectuur: custom domein, cloud platform, data flow
- Zet de sGTM server container op en configureer deze
- Migreer je tags: GA4, Google Ads, Facebook CAPI
- Activeer Enhanced Conversions voor maximale conversie-attributie
- Monitor en optimaliseer: vergelijk data voor en na de migratie
Wil je weten hoeveel data jouw bedrijf mist? Bij Saerens Advertising voeren we een gratis tracking-audit uit waarbij we exact in kaart brengen hoeveel conversies je niet ziet. We helpen je vervolgens met een professionele server-side tracking implementatie zodat je weer het volledige plaatje hebt. Neem contact op voor een vrijblijvend gesprek.
Gerelateerde Artikelen
Hulp nodig met uw marketing?
Vraag vandaag nog een gratis audit aan en ontdek waar u kansen laat liggen.


